Transaction 3abe639ba5034e23e6067d2f9070d641ecab3527f85ed8e5590c9a261ee9e154
1 Input
1 Output
-
3abe639ba5034e23e6067d2f9070d641ecab3527f85ed8e5590c9a261ee9e154:0
- value
- 305686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1151cbd51718e0639b346bb19b9c7f383f29bde OP_EQUAL
- address
- 3ND9FcR1Npok1Pc3Ao4fhMe5ecbRPYc9tG